Text Based Digital Interventions Prompting Enjoyable and Healthy Behaviors
NCT06492824 · View on ClinicalTrials.gov ↗
Study Summary
The proposed project aims to examine the effectiveness of an automated digital (i.e., text message based) intervention prompting adults with at least moderate depressive symptoms to complete enjoyable daily activities (i.e., Behavioral Activation \[BA\]) over the course of one month compared to adults with moderate or more depressive symptoms that complete an active and a passive control condition broadly prompting a healthier lifestyle or no prompts at all. More specifically, we aim to examine if the BA intervention will improve mental health and overall well-being among adults experiencing moderate or more symptoms of depression over and beyond the active and passive control conditions. We will measure symptoms such as current depression, anxiety, and stress pre- and post- interventions to determine their effectiveness.

Trial Details
| Field | Value |
|---|---|
| Enrollment Target | 156 participants |
| Start Date | 2022-11-01 |
| Est. Completion | 2023-02-01 |
| Phase | NA |
